Integrative analyses reveal signaling pathways underlying familial breast cancer susceptibility.
Molecular systems biology - 10 Mar 2016
Piccolo Stephen R, Hoffman Laura M, Conner Thomas, Shrestha Gajendra, Cohen Adam L, Marks Jeffrey R, Neumayer Leigh A, Agarwal Cori A, Beckerle Mary C, Andrulis Irene L, Spira Avrum E, Moos Philip J, Buys Saundra S, Johnson William Evan, Bild Andrea H
Abstract excerpt
The signaling events that drive familial breast cancer (FBC) risk remain poorly understood. While the majority of genomic studies have focused on genetic risk variants, known risk variants account for at most 30% of FBC cases.
